Ghanaians dont learn from what happened in the past: People rush to collect fuel after fuel tank accident (video)

On Sunday afternoon, a petrol truck that toppled into a gutter in Kaase, a Kumasi suburb, sparked a frenzied rush for fuel.

According to all indications, some Ghanaians do not appear to be learning from prior sad incidents that claimed the lives of countless people.

The recent Apiatse disaster, in which roughly 15 people died after a vehicle carrying mining explosives crashed and caught fire, is a good example.

Those who thought they could record the moment by getting close to the blazing car died, and it appears that the people of Kaase are so stupid to risk their lives over fuel that won’t last a lifetime.

Some Ghanaians who don’t appear to learn anything were seen with their respective rubbers, gallons hurrying to where the tanker had overturned to retrieve some of its petroleum in a video posted on social media.
